Pin On Msm Designz
Pin On Albas Restaurant
Tarry Lodge Port Chester Port Chester Ny On Opentable Lodge Port Chester Ny Restaurants
Pin On Albas Restaurant
Pin On Albas Restaurant
Pin On Live A Little
Pin On Albas Restaurant
Pin On Albas Restaurant
Pin On Albas Restaurant
Pin On Albas Restaurant